#include <node.h>
#include <uv.h>
#include <assert.h>
void MustNotCall(void* arg, void(*cb)(void*), void* cbarg) {
assert(0);
}
struct AsyncData {
uv_async_t async;
v8::Isolate* isolate;
node::AsyncCleanupHookHandle handle;
void (*done_cb)(void*);
void* done_arg;
};
void AsyncCleanupHook(void* arg, void(*cb)(void*), void* cbarg) {
AsyncData* data = static_cast<AsyncData*>(arg);
uv_loop_t* loop = node::GetCurrentEventLoop(data->isolate);
assert(loop != nullptr);
int err = uv_async_init(loop, &data->async, [](uv_async_t* async) {
AsyncData* data = static_cast<AsyncData*>(async->data);
// Attempting to remove the cleanup hook here should be a no-op since it
// has already been started.
node::RemoveEnvironmentCleanupHook(std::move(data->handle));
uv_close(reinterpret_cast<uv_handle_t*>(async), [](uv_handle_t* handle) {
AsyncData* data = static_cast<AsyncData*>(handle->data);
data->done_cb(data->done_arg);
delete data;
});
});
assert(err == 0);
data->async.data = data;
data->done_cb = cb;
data->done_arg = cbarg;
uv_async_send(&data->async);
}
void Initialize(v8::Local<v8::Object> exports,
v8::Local<v8::Value> module,
v8::Local<v8::Context> context) {
AsyncData* data = new AsyncData();
data->isolate = context->GetIsolate();
auto handle = node::AddEnvironmentCleanupHook(
context->GetIsolate(),
AsyncCleanupHook,
data);
data->handle = std::move(handle);
auto must_not_call_handle = node::AddEnvironmentCleanupHook(
context->GetIsolate(),
MustNotCall,
nullptr);
node::RemoveEnvironmentCleanupHook(std::move(must_not_call_handle));
}
NODE_MODULE_CONTEXT_AWARE(NODE_GYP_MODULE_NAME, Initialize)
